FTC chair Lina Khan pledges to use all tools to in­ves­ti­gate PBMs

KANSAS CITY, Mo. — Phar­ma­cy ben­e­fit man­agers have be­come a thorn in the side of the phar­ma and in­sur­ance in­dus­tries in re­cent years, and just a cou­ple of months af­ter the Fed­er­al Trade Com­mis­sion sig­naled it would in­ves­ti­gate un­law­ful PBM prac­tices, FTC chair Lina Khan is look­ing to turn up the heat even more.

Khan sat down with Na­tion­al Com­mu­ni­ty Phar­ma­cists As­so­ci­a­tion CEO Dou­glas Hoey on Mon­day morn­ing at the NC­PA’s an­nu­al con­ven­tion, with a fire­side chat in the heart of the Mid­west.
